Definition
/ˌlɪkwəˈdeɪʃən/
noun
- The act of exchange of an asset of lesser liquidity with a more liquid one, such as cash.
- The selling of the assets of a business as part of the process of dissolving the business.“The store is having a liquidation sale: everything must go as they go out of business.”
- Murder of dehumanized victims by a regime (and possibly its allies).
